Gujarat Govt. to launch a free treatment scheme for road accident victims

Published on May 19, 2018
The Gujarat Government launched a free treatment scheme for road accident victims.


  • It would provide free treatment for the first 48 hours to all victims of road accidents.
  • It aims to offer timely and effective care to the victims and thereby minimize the loss of life.
  • This announcement was made by the Deputy Chief Minister of Gujarat Nitin Patel.
  • The Government will provide up to Rs. 50,000 in medical treatment for the first 48 hours for each individual who meets with a road accident in the state.
  • The government would reimburse the amount to the hospital concerned upon submission of bills.
  • In certain cases where a hospital refers the patient to another hospital within 48 hours, both the hospitals will be eligible for the reimbursement of their combined bill of Rs 50,000.
  • The scheme will benefit not only the people of Gujarat but also people from other states and even citizens of other countries who are travelling within the state.
